To the OP, yes there is something very bad going on here. We were all promised something that never happened. (You will be ANC based). This was true for about 2 months off of OE. Then it started with hey can you help us out down in PDX for a week? Hey can you help us out one more time? Then it started with hey we NEED you to go down to PDX, this time for a few weeks, then a month... we were all told that this would stop by late december, however now it's only gotten worse. Many of us ANC guys are now down here in denver with long duty days, cancelations, living out of hotel for the month and most likely next month for all of us already here. QOL is non existant down here. Sure if I lived here it wouldnt be THAT bad but it's the whole principle of the matter. I came to penair to live in alaska and do something different. A huge change for anyone in that situation. Now we are being forced down to TDY for months on end just with a small chance of hope that maybe just maybe next months bid will be better. Well Feb bid is almost out and all of us will still be TDY down in denver. It's not good here. Huge difference between the pilots and managment. Anyone in training now or thinking of it, get out while you can.
